《MLDN学习笔记》是李兴华针对Java SE的一份详细学习资料,主要涵盖了Java的基础知识、面向对象编程、Eclipse开发工具的使用、类集框架、常用类库、多线程以及IO操作等多个核心领域。这些文档以Word格式提供,相较于常见的PDF格式,更加便于编辑和查阅。 1. **Java SE基础部分**: - Java编程语言的基本语法,包括变量、数据类型、运算符、流程控制语句等。 - 类和对象的概念,以及如何定义和实例化它们。 - 异常处理机制,如何使用try-catch-finally结构来捕获和处理异常。 - 包的使用,理解包的作用以及如何创建和导入包。 2. **面向对象(基础)**: - 面向对象编程的基本概念,如封装、继承和多态。 - 构造函数和析构函数的使用,以及它们在对象生命周期中的作用。 - 访问修饰符(public、private、protected)的理解及其在类设计中的应用。 - 抽象类和接口的区别与使用场景。 3. **Eclipse开发工具**: - Eclipse IDE的安装、配置及基本操作,如创建项目、编写代码、调试程序等。 - 使用Eclipse进行版本控制,如Git的集成和使用。 - 插件的安装与使用,提高开发效率。 4. **Java类集框架**: - Collection框架的核心接口,如List、Set、Queue及其实现类的特性与使用。 - Map接口及其实现类HashMap、TreeMap等,理解键值对的概念。 - 集合操作,如迭代、过滤、转换等。 5. **Java常用类库**: - String类的常用方法,如concat、substring、indexOf等。 - Date和Calendar类的使用,处理日期和时间。 - IO流的分类,如字节流、字符流,以及缓冲流和转换流的应用。 6. **多线程**: - 创建线程的方式,如实现Runnable接口和继承Thread类。 - 线程同步机制,如synchronized关键字、wait/notify、Semaphore等。 - 线程池的使用,如ExecutorService和ThreadPoolExecutor。 7. **Java IO操作**: - 文件操作,包括读写文件、复制文件、删除文件等。 - 字符流与字节流的转换,以及BufferedReader和BufferedWriter等缓冲流的使用。 - 文件流与对象流的区别,理解序列化和反序列化过程。 这份资料详细且深入地讲解了Java SE的各个方面,适合初学者入门和进阶者巩固提升。通过系统学习,读者可以掌握Java编程的基本技能,并具备独立开发Java应用程序的能力。
- 1
- qingyou2502012-12-21的确是不错的,就是有一张有问题~~~
- kanelovegigi22013-05-09很不错,网上一般都是PDF的还没书签,看起来不方便,这个有WORD有目录索引,很方便。
- 粉丝: 0
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- YOLOv8完整网络结构图详细visio
- LCD1602电子时钟程序
- 西北太平洋热带气旋【灾害风险统计】及【登陆我国次数评估】数据集-1980-2023
- 全球干旱数据集【自校准帕尔默干旱程度指数scPDSI】-190101-202312-0.5x0.5
- 基于Python实现的VAE(变分自编码器)训练算法源代码+使用说明
- 全球干旱数据集【标准化降水蒸发指数SPEI-12】-190101-202312-0.5x0.5
- C语言小游戏-五子棋-详细代码可运行
- 全球干旱数据集【标准化降水蒸发指数SPEI-03】-190101-202312-0.5x0.5
- spring boot aop记录修改前后的值demo
- 全球干旱数据集【标准化降水蒸发指数SPEI-01】-190101-202312-0.5x0.5